LPD: $3,000 in cigarettes stolen from Stop and Shop
Police say 2 people broke into a convenience store on Sunday, stealing $3,000 worth of cigarettes

LINCOLN, Neb. (KLKN)- On April 18, around 3 a.m., Lincoln police were called to the Stop and Shop on South 16th Steet on the report of a burglary.
The manager of the store told LPD that she had received an alarm and when she arrived at the store, she found the front door glass had been shattered.
When officers reviewed the security footage, they reported seeing two individuals with their faces covered entered the store, steal multiple cartons of cigarettes valued at over $3,000, and then fled the scene.
Police say they are looking into the incident further to determine if it’s possibly related to a similar one that happened recently. This is an ongoing investigation, anyone with information is encouraged to call LPD at 402-441-6000 or Crime Stoppers at 402-475-3600.
